  3. Economics & Philosophy -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Economics_&_Philosophy

    Economics & Philosophy is a triannual peer-reviewed academic journal covering different aspects of philosophy and economics.It was established in 1985 and is published by Cambridge University Press.

  5. Institutional economics -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Institutional_economics

    Institutional economics focuses on understanding the role of the evolutionary process and the role of institutions in shaping economic behavior.Its original focus lay in Thorstein Veblen's instinct-oriented dichotomy between technology on the one side and the "ceremonial" sphere of society on the other.
